Friction Stir Processing (FSP) is a novel technique that offers remarkable potential for enhancing the formability of materials at low temperatures. This revolutionary process has gained significant attention in the manufacturing industry due to its ability to enhance the strength, ductility, and overall performance of various materials, including metals and alloys. In this article, we delve deeper into the concept of Friction Stir Processing and explore its benefits, applications, and future prospects.

Understanding Friction Stir Processing

Friction Stir Processing involves the use of a specialized tool that rotates and traverses along the material's surface, generating intense heat and mechanical forces. This frictional heating allows for significant plastic deformation of the material, which leads to enhanced low temperature formability. The key advantage of FSP over conventional processing techniques is that it minimizes the formation of defects, such as cracks and voids, ensuring a more robust and reliable end product.

Benefits of Friction Stir Processing

1. Enhanced Formability: FSP improves the formability of materials, making them easier to shape and mold at low temperatures. This is particularly advantageous in industries such as aerospace, automotive, and construction, where complex components with intricate geometries need to be manufactured.

2. Improved Mechanical Properties: FSP significantly enhances the mechanical properties of materials, including their strength, ductility, and fatigue resistance. This makes them more suitable for demanding applications that require high-performance materials.

3. Reduced Defects: Friction Stir Processing minimizes the formation of defects, such as voids, cracks, and porosity, which are commonly associated with traditional manufacturing techniques like casting and welding. The result is a superior quality product with increased reliability.

Applications of Friction Stir Processing

Friction Stir Processing finds extensive applications across various industries:

1. Aerospace

The aerospace industry benefits significantly from FSP as it allows for the production of lightweight components with excellent mechanical properties. These components, including aircraft panels and structural elements, require enhanced low temperature formability and structural integrity.

2. Automotive

In the automotive industry, FSP can be employed to manufacture body panels, engine parts, and suspension components that demand improved strength, corrosion resistance, and formability.

3. Construction

Friction Stir Processing is also relevant in the construction sector, particularly for the production of structural elements with superior strength, durability, and low-temperature formability. This includes products like beams, columns, and bridges.

The Future of Friction Stir Processing

The future prospects of Friction Stir Processing look promising. With ongoing advancements in tool materials, process parameters, and computer simulations, FSP is expected to become more efficient, cost-effective, and widely adopted in various industries. Furthermore, research is underway to explore the limits of FSP in terms of processing different material combinations and creating tailored microstructures.

Friction Stir Processing is a cutting-edge technique that offers immense potential for enhancing the formability of materials at low temperatures. With its ability to improve mechanical properties, reduce defects, and find applications in industries such as aerospace, automotive, and construction, FSP is revolutionizing the manufacturing industry. As research and development in this field continue to progress, we can anticipate even more remarkable advancements that will shape the future of materials processing.

The use of friction stir processing to locally modify the microstructure to enhanced formability has the potential to alter the manufacturing of structural shapes. There is enough research to put together a short monograph detailing the fundamentals and key findings. One example of conventional manufacturing technique for aluminum alloys involves fusion welding of 5XXX series alloys. This can be replaced by friction stir welding, friction stir processing and forming. A major advantage of this switch is the enhanced properties. However qualification of any new process involves a series of tests to prove that material properties of interest in the friction stir welded or processed regions meet or exceed those of the fusion welded region (conventional approach). This book will provide a case study of Al5083 alloy with some additional examples of high strength aluminum alloys.

  • Demonstrates how friction stir processing enabled forming can expand the design space by using thick sheet/plate for applications where pieces are joined because of lack of formability
  • Opens up new method for manufacturing of structural shapes
  • Shows how the process has the potential to lower the cost of a finished structure and enhance the design allowables
